Abstract
Silver nanowires with diameter around 100 nanometers were synthesized by a simple polyol method through the mediation of ferrum and tin species. The obtained Ag nanowires were uniform with diameter around 100nm and length up to 50μm. The formation mechanism of the Ag nanowires mediated by Fe and Sn ions was that the metal ions could prevent the oxide etching of seeds.
